Grease is the word

By DJ Tryba on May 11, 2008 at 11:57am | No Comments (Add) | 17 Views

Anyone remember how much shortening was last October? Are you sitting down? Do you really want to know how much more it costs per case this year than it did last year? Answer: $13.75/case. Yep, that’s right, $10 a case more than last year’s price. If you use 10 cases... more
